The biggest and most beautiful natural attraction of course is the Lake Geneva, this is the famous Swiss Riviera! The embankment just fascinates - the mountain peaks and a calm water surface of the crystal-pure lake. The most picturesque is usually considered Embankment OUCHY. Here it is very pleasant to walk in the shade of massive chestnuts. At the water itself stands the Cateau d'Ouchy castle, he was built by a bishop in the 12th century.

Unfortunately, today the castle is not a museum, there is a hotel in its room, and it is not even cheaper.

If you get to break away from these landscapes, it is worth seeing architectural and historical sights and perhaps the biggest and most important of them are considered Notre Dame Cathedral which is included in the list of the most beautiful churches of Europe. Its construction began in the 12th century and lasted as much as 100 years. In the building, magnificent stained glass windows, arches, choirs and all elements of the decorations of the Gothic style are preserved, and even it is here that the largest body of Switzerland has 7,000 pipes.

Not far from the cathedral, another church is located, more precisely, the cathedral, which also deserves attention - Church of St. Francis. The church was built in the 13th century as the monastery temple, he experienced a lot of fires, but the external design and architecture did not change.

Bypassing the side is impossible to Rippon's area on which is located Palace Ryumin who was a squeezing nest of Vasily Bestumev-Ryumin and his supega Catherine. Now in the palace, which amazes with its architectural delight, there are several museums - archaeological, geological, zoological and historical, and the library works. From Monday to Friday, the museums and the library are open from 7 am to 10 pm, on Saturday the palace is open to visit from 7 am to 5 pm, and on Sunday from 10 am to 5 pm.

Also worth a visit Saint Marie Castle , which was built in the 15th century and belonged to the bishop. In the building there are a lot of labyrinths and secret moves, thanks to which at the time of the reformation, the last bishop and was able to escape, avoiding death. Now this building serves as a meeting place at the Canton Government meeting. Address: 5, Rue De La Barre.

As for museums, they are also plenty of them here. Since it is in Lausanne that a sports arbitration court and Olympic headquarters are located, then it is here that you can visit Olympic Museum . In the museum you can see how the Olympic form changed over the years and how sports evolved. The cups, medals, various documents are stored here ...
